Output 7984d0eaec100e9a6c1d5676c99b84af83e9474fa30244cfaf6b534fc0e10384:3

value
292720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da40eb433f37ca9c2597803d5b141ef9f908133 OP_EQUAL
address
34Pk41xp4fx3SRkF9Q4XLUghBTL7bbRxEe
transaction
7984d0eaec100e9a6c1d5676c99b84af83e9474fa30244cfaf6b534fc0e10384
spent
true